134230782 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ixty-four divisors.
Prime factorization of 134230782:
2 × 3 × 7 × 19 × 59 × 2851

Factors of 134230782
Divisors of 134230782
- Number of divisors d(n): 64
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 3 6 7 14 19 21 38 42 57 59 114 118 133 177 266 354 399 413 798 826 1121 1239 2242 2478 2851 3363 5702 6726 7847 8553 15694 17106 19957 23541 39914 47082 54169 59871 108338 119742 162507 168209 325014 336418 379183 504627 758366 1009254 1137549 1177463 2275098 2354926 3195971 3532389 6391942 7064778 9587913 19175826 22371797 44743594 67115391 134230782
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 328550400
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 194319618
- 134230782 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(194319618)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 60088836
